About Susu Wang
Susu Wang is a scholar working on Health, Toxicology and Mutagenesis, Mechanics of Materials, Soil Science, Molecular Biology and Mechanical Engineering, having authored 58 papers that have together received 1.1k indexed citations. Recurring topics across this work include Composting and Vermicomposting Techniques (11 papers), Heavy Metal Exposure and Toxicity (10 papers), Analytical Chemistry and Chromatography (5 papers), Trace Elements in Health (5 papers), Mercury impact and mitigation studies (5 papers), Petroleum Processing and Analysis (4 papers), Hydrocarbon exploration and reservoir analysis (4 papers) and Air Quality and Health Impacts (3 papers). The work is most often cited by research in Soil Science (330 citations), Pollution (233 citations), Industrial and Manufacturing Engineering (120 citations), Health, Toxicology and Mutagenesis (148 citations) and Nutrition and Dietetics (75 citations). Susu Wang has collaborated with scholars based in China, United States and Gambia. Frequent co-authors include Qunliang Li, Qiuqi Niu, Qingran Meng, Hailong Yan, Qiuhui Zhu, F. J. McGarry, J. F. Mandell, Xiangmei Ren, Gen Li and Kecheng Li. Their work appears in journals such as Ecotoxicology and Environmental Safety, Bioresource Technology, Journal of Environmental Management, Organic Geochemistry and Environmental Science and Pollution Research.
